Former Premier League Star Bacary Sagna Shares Profound Insights on Navigating Grief in Professional Football
Published on Friday, 18 July 2025 at 3:20 am
The football world remains gripped by sorrow following the devastating news of Diogo Jota’s tragic death. The Liverpool striker, just 28, along with his younger brother André Silva, 25, also a professional footballer, perished in a car crash on July 3, sending shockwaves through the sporting community. As Liverpool Football Club grapples with the immense void left by such a profound loss, a familiar voice from the Premier League past has emerged to offer solace and crucial advice: Bacary Sagna. The former Arsenal and Manchester City stalwart, a veteran of 65 caps for the French national team, understands the unique agony of playing through an unimaginable personal tragedy, and his message to the grieving Reds squad is clear: confront your pain, and speak about it.
Sagna’s empathetic plea stems from a deeply personal place. Early in his distinguished career, during his formative years at Arsenal in 2008, he endured the indescribable pain of losing his own brother. The demands of elite football, with its relentless schedule and intense public scrutiny, offer little respite for personal suffering. Sagna knows firsthand the isolating struggle of trying to maintain focus on the pitch while his world off it had crumbled. His experience highlights a seldom-discussed facet of professional sports: the expectation for athletes to perform at their peak, even when their personal lives are in turmoil. The emotional weight of such a loss can be crippling, impacting not just performance but overall well-being, often far from the public eye.
In a candid conversation with CNN’s Senior Sports Analyst, Darren Lewis, Sagna revealed the difficult journey of learning to live with grief. He emphasized that bottling up emotions, or attempting to compartmentalize such profound sorrow, is detrimental. Instead, he advocates for open communication and seeking professional support, urging the Liverpool players to lean on each other, their club’s support staff, and mental health professionals.
